"10 Second Sell A global study of current practice in online teaching and learning in higher education, exploring online course delivery, pedagogical approaches to online teaching, educational tools and more. Rationale to Publish: Strategy University lockdowns during the pandemic have accelerated the growth of online higher education, embedding it as an everyday reality for many HE disciplines around the world. This handbook offers a truly global overview of the topic with a clear focus on the pragmatic elements of how, and in what ways, online HE is being implemented.
